If you adhere to basic safety guidelines, using a bioethanol fire will not pose an issue. Be sure it’s not located in a place that is flammable and that you keep it at least 1m away from all other structures. Never move a biofire that is already lit or attempt to refill the fuel while it is still burning. This could result in serious burns.

Secure

Ethanol fireplaces can be used to heat your home safely because they do not emit harmful pollutants. However, it is still necessary to take the necessary precautions to protect yourself and your family from the dangers posed by this type of fire. You should only make use of bioethanol that has been deemed safe by the manufacturer for this purpose. Additionally, you must make sure that the fuel is kept in a secure location, out of the reach of children and pets.
